6th Grade played at home and were sent in to bat by Piara Waters. A not so good start saw us teetering at 5/35 but some graet batting from Haroon Ahmed with a 50 and some big hitting from Farooq Ali with 34 saw us reach a defendable total of 161. Piara Waters were looking the goods at 1/64 but an inspired spell from Farooq 2/9 and Vijay Kumar 3/12 with a couple of run outs saw the visitors crash to be all out for 120. A great first up win for the Tigers.
7th grade travelled to Forrestdale and were sent in to bat. After losing Vinnie early, Dempsey Badorek 56 and Matt Pedulla 26 put on 98 togetherand then fine contributions from captain Steve Hall 30 and Jack Robb 20no saw us post a good total of 6/178. A good start with the ball saw Forrestdale at 4/76 and the game on the fence, but some strong partnerships got them over the line with a final score of 7/196. Great bowling from Reddy Madamshetti with 3/22 and a very special 1/41 from Paul Mclean saw Macca reach 400 wickets for the Tigers.
Milestones for the Tigers
Paul Mclean took his wicket tally for the Tigers to 400 on the weekend. Paul is just the 4th Tiger to pass the 400 mark so he now has in his sights Aaron Dyer 408, Mark Richards 432 and a very distant Frank MacGrotty 592. Paul has taken his wickets at an average of 19.98 with 6 five wicket hauls and a best of 5/15. Congratulations Macca!
